Output ec6e96b24d40f79dacad6ff088ffdb9e4b7b7ca310a1925b79e2f6c738564fa6:0

value
10131452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c423adbaa5f29b2948961b73ddc6221507cb4376 OP_EQUAL
address
3Ka778uau2vbdcpXE782prqQ1RTbqJvgxh
transaction
ec6e96b24d40f79dacad6ff088ffdb9e4b7b7ca310a1925b79e2f6c738564fa6
spent
true